Sail Rocket have just hit 33 knots in 16 knots of wind, which is pretty impressive stuff. However...... Crossbow reached 36 knots in 1980 and Yellow Pages record of 46.52 knots ( in 19 knots of wind ! ) stood for years until recently topped by a board. There are plenty of speed experts on this forum, so my question is, do we think Sail Rocket will crack the 50 knot barrier ? My view is that control is an issue above 20 knots of wind, unless you have a board. This alone will make the 50 knot + barrier a tough one. Therefore, boat speed as a multiple of wind speed becomes the key factor, ie efficiency. Of course, if you can control the beast, then higher wind speeds are an option - Moths even top 26 knots conforming to their class rules !
